Rosie O’Donnell received a standing ovation as she made her guest-hosting debut on Jimmy Kimmel Live! on Monday (August 17) and wasted no time in taunting President Donald Trump.
“Thank you, thank you,” the former View co-host said as the studio audience clapped and chanted her name. She responded by performing a mock version of Trump’s trademark fist-pumping dance moves.
“They said you can’t come home again, but here I am,” O’Donnell said, referring to her move to Ireland following Trump’s 2024 presidential election victory. In a social media post last year, the president threatened to take away O’Donnell’s U.S. citizenship.
“And if you thought the president hated Jimmy Kimmel Live when it was hosted by Jimmy Kimmel, buckle up, people, buckle up,” she continued to more rapturous applause.
She went on to say, “I’ve been living in Ireland for the past two years because of Mango Mussolini. I read that Project 2025 and said, ‘Got to get myself out of here. And I decided to go to Ireland, a place where people are driven to drink, regardless of who’s running their country.”
O’Donnell recalled telling her then 11-year-old kid, Clay, not to tell anyone about the move because she didn’t want the press. “They went to school and proceeded to tell their entire class, ‘I’m very sorry. I won’t be able to graduate sixth grade with you. I’m being forced to move to another country because the president of the United States hates my mother. But in all fairness, I believe my mother hates him more.’”
The A League of Their Own star then looked directly into the camera and waved, taunting, “Hi, I know you’re watching.”
As she wrapped up her monologue, O’Donnell took one more shot at Trump, saying, “And you know, right now he’s in the White House crying because I haven’t mentioned him.”
Notably, O’Donnell didn’t refer to Trump by name in her entire monologue, only calling him the president.
Kimmel previously announced O’Donnell would be serving as one of his guest hosts while he is on a two-month summer hiatus. “As a special treat for our commander-in-chief, I asked one of his all-time favorites, Rosie O’Donnell, to be here to keep the hits coming,” he said.
The feud between O’Donnell and Trump has been going on for years. Last year, the Emmy-winning talk show host told the Irish network RTÉ’s The Late Late Show that the president has “had it out” for her for 20 years after she “told the truth about him on a program called The View.”
O’Donnell, who has been back in the spotlight in recent months, including performing her one-woman show, Common Knowledge, in New York City, told the Good Hang with Amy Poehler podcast last week that Trump is basically the one responsible for her resurgence.
“I think it’s [Trump] who did it,” she said. “He didn’t know. If he knew how much he was helping my career and life, he would shut up about me, because you know, he’s a horrible creature.”
